El diseño web es el trabajo que se lleva a cabo al planificar, programar y poner en marcha un sitio web. El concepto hace referencia a las actividades que se ejecutan desde que comienza a proyectarse una publicación virtual hasta que los contenidos ya están disponibles en Internet.
Debe considerarse que el diseño implica delinear, proyectar o configurar algo. El término web, en tanto, alude a una red informática: generalmente refiere específicamente a la World Wide Web (WWW), la red que funciona mediante Internet y que permite la transmisión de datos vía el Protocolo de Transferencia de Hipertextos (HTTP).
Sin entrar en cuestiones técnicas, el diseño web es aquello que se realiza para crear, organizar y publicar un sitio en Internet. Estas acciones pueden desarrollarse con distintos recursos y apelando a herramientas y software de distinto tipo.
Características del diseño web
Para comprender qué es el diseño web, resulta imprescindible tener en claro varias nociones. Como punto de partida, hay que saber que un sitio web es un conjunto de páginas web interrelacionadas que se encuentran disponibles un subdominio o dominio de Internet. Esto supone que el sitio web cuenta con una dirección específica en la WWW, la cual permite acceder a la página web principal o portada (también llamada home page). Los documentos, en este contexto, deben contar con alojamiento (hosting) en un servidor.
El diseño web consiste en la creación de todas las páginas que componen un sitio. Esto requiere la elaboración de los documentos que se vinculan a través de enlaces y que pueden incluir textos, imágenes y sonidos.
Las tareas de diseño web pueden concretarse con un editor de texto para la escritura del código HTML (el lenguaje de marcado de hipertexto) o con un software de tipo WYSIWYG (que permite crear y modificar los documentos sin la necesidad de escribir el código fuente en HTML, ya que el programa lo hace de forma automática). Entre los editores WYSIWYG aparecen programas como Adobe Dreamweaver y gestores de contenido como WordPress y Wix.
El objetivo del diseño web, en definitiva, es crear un sitio web y ponerlo a disposición de los visitantes. Esto exige cumplir con ciertos criterios vinculados a la usabilidad y la accesibilidad. En los últimos años se popularizó la idea de diseño adaptable (responsive design), que refiere a un diseño que puede visualizarse de forma correcta en diferentes dispositivos (computadoras, teléfonos, etc.).
Lenguajes de programación y tecnologías
El diseño web exige trabajar con diversos lenguajes de programación y tecnologías. El HTML es elemental ya que se usa para estructurar el texto y el resto de los elementos, haciendo que el contenido pueda verse desde un navegador.
Para definir el aspecto visual y la UI (User Interface) creados en HTML se suele apelar a CSS: Cascading Style Sheets, expresión inglesa traducible como Hojas de estilo en cascada. Se trata de un lenguaje de diseño gráfico que indica cómo debe presentarse un documento escrito en un lenguaje de marcado (como es el caso del HTML).
Con JavaScript también se trabaja en la UI y se pueden producir contenidos interactivos y animaciones, por ejemplo. Otro lenguaje que se utiliza con frecuencia en el diseño web es PHP.
Debe tenerse en cuenta que el diseño web cuenta con una doble perspectiva: la visualización del internauta (front-end) y del administrador del sitio web (back-end). Los métodos y técnicas de diseño deben tener en cuenta ambos tipos de necesidades.
El diseño web y la difusión de los contenidos
En el campo del diseño web no alcanza con cumplir las exigencias técnicas y cuidar la estética. Es indispensable que ya desde el inicio de un proyecto de sitio web se examine cómo se logrará que los contenidos tengan repercusión; es decir, que el sitio web sea visitado por los usuarios.
Es clave, en este sentido, que el diseño web se desarrolle según los parámetros SEO (Search Engine Optimization). Esto quiere decir que el diseño debe responder a los lineamientos de los buscadores para estar bien posicionado.
Cuando un usuario introduce un término o una frase en un buscador, obtiene una página con los resultados de la búsqueda. Dicha página es un listado que muestra los sitios web relacionados con lo buscado, los cuales se exhiben en un cierto orden. Es mucho más probable que el internauta ingrese a los sitio web que aparecen en los primeros lugares que aquellos que se muestran más abajo o incluso en otra página de resultados.
Por lo tanto, el diseñador web tiene que seguir las técnicas SEO si pretende que su sitio tenga un buen posicionamiento. Incluir palabras clave (keywords) y retroenleaces (backlinks) en los textos es trascendental.
Otro concepto importante es SEM (Search Engine Marketing). En este caso, se admite la posibilidad de pagar para aparecer en los primeros resultados de búsqueda. Quien está a cargo del diseño web, pues, puede considerar esta opción para garantizar una mayor visibilidad.
Entre las herramientas que ayudan a medir la popularidad de un sitio web se destaca Google Analytics. Sus informes contribuyen a entender de qué modo están funcionando el diseño web y los contenidos a la hora de atraer a los visitantes.
La importancia de la seguridad
La seguridad web es otro aspecto que debe contemplarse desde el diseño. Es necesario instrumentar las medidas necesarias para prevenir los ataques y para minimizar el daño si se concreta un atentado o una violación.
Los expertos recomiendan utilizar el Protocolo Seguro de Transferencia de Hipertexto (HTTPS según la sigla en inglés), que utiliza el cifrado SSL/TLS para la protección. Con la encriptación de las comunicaciones y mecanismos de autenticación y autorización, las publicaciones de un sitio web resultan menos vulnerables.
Otra acción necesaria es crear copias de seguridad (backups) de los contenidos. Así, se puede restablecer la versión original un sitio web que ha sido atacado o infectado.